What chemical makes up the rungs (as if it were a ladder)?
lesson DNA

Respuesta :

angeljomarsal2021
angeljomarsal2021 angeljomarsal2021
  • 01-02-2022
In DNA, the "rungs" between the two strands of DNA are formed from the nitrogenous bases adenine, thymine, guanine and cytosine
